Danish labour law changes
If you have employees in Denmark, it is extremely important to know both the legal obligations imposed on you as an employer and your rights in relation to the employees.
Historically the trade unions (a-kasse wiki) and the employers’ associations, have played a very active and significant role in the development of the labour market in Denmark.
The Danish labour market is in many ways significantly different from what you may have experienced in other jurisdictions.
The purpose of this press release is to give you an overall idea of the Danish labour market and to point out some of the aspects you need to consider as an employer in Denmark.
The security available to Danish employees is significant both through legal protection and through social security.
